arlas-web-components / Exports / CalendarTimelineComponent
Class: CalendarTimelineComponent
Implements
AfterViewInit
OnChanges
OnDestroy
Table of contents
Constructors
Properties
- boundDates
- climatological
- cursorPosition
- data
- granularity
- height
- hideLeftButton
- hideRightButton
- hoveredData
- id
- selectedData
- translate
- width
Methods
Constructors
constructor
• new CalendarTimelineComponent()
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:61
Properties
boundDates
• boundDates: Date
[] = []
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:42
climatological
• climatological: boolean
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:41
cursorPosition
• cursorPosition: Date
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:44
data
• data: TimelineData
[] = []
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:43
granularity
• granularity: Granularity
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:40
height
• height: number
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:53
hideLeftButton
• hideLeftButton: boolean
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:45
hideRightButton
• hideRightButton: boolean
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:46
hoveredData
• hoveredData: Subject
<TimelineTooltip
>
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:49
id
• id: string
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:39
selectedData
• selectedData: Subject
<TimelineData
>
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:48
translate
• translate: Subject
<TranslationDirection
>
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:50
width
• width: number
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:52
Methods
ngAfterViewInit
▸ ngAfterViewInit(): void
Returns
void
Implementation of
AfterViewInit.ngAfterViewInit
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:99
ngOnChanges
▸ ngOnChanges(changes
): void
Parameters
Name | Type |
---|---|
changes |
SimpleChanges |
Returns
void
Implementation of
OnChanges.ngOnChanges
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:77
ngOnDestroy
▸ ngOnDestroy(): void
Returns
void
Implementation of
OnDestroy.ngOnDestroy
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:122
plot
▸ plot(): void
Returns
void
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:127
translateFuture
▸ translateFuture(): void
Returns
void
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:133
translatePast
▸ translatePast(): void
Returns
void
Defined in
projects/arlas-components/src/lib/components/calendar-timeline/calendar-timeline.component.ts:137